55 new COVID-19 cases reported Monday in Quad County area

  • Discuss Comment, Blog about
  • Print Friendly and PDF

Carson City Health and Human Services (CCHHS) is reporting 55 new cases and 25 additional recoveries of COVID-19 in the Quad-County Region; 23 of these additional 55 new cases are from the Warm Springs Correctional Facility in Carson City.

This brings the total number of cases to 2,693, with 1,973 recoveries and 27 deaths; 693 cases remain active.

Carson City Health and Human Services is working to identify close risk contacts to prevent further spread of the disease.

Drive-Thru Flu Vaccination & COVID-19 Testing for Quad-County Residents

For convenience, CCHHS is contracted to bill most insurances. For uninsured we ask for a $20 administration fee; however, no one will be turned away for the inability to pay. CCHHS is not contracted with Tricare or labor unions. Testing is free of charge; first come, first served, no appointments or reservations.

Quad-County COVID-19 Hotline: New Phone Number

Starting Tuesday, November 17th the phone number will be (775)434-1988. The hotline is staffed Monday through Friday, 8:30 a.m. to 4:30 p.m. The change is required to handle the volume of calls regarding questions about COVID and the number of people interested in being tested.
